Dr. Steven Kodros is a Orthopedic surgeon and Orthopedist in Chicago 60625, Chicago and has an experience of 38 years in these fields. Dr. Steven Kodros practices at Swedish Hospital in Chicago 60625, Chicago and NorthShore Medical Group in Chicago 60611, Chicago. He completed Fellowship from Baylor College of Medicine in 1994,Residency from Northwestern University Feinberg School of Medicine in 1993 and Medical School from University of Illinois College of Medicine in 1988. He is a member of Alpha Omega Alpha Medical Honor Society,AMERICAN MEDICAL ASSOCIATION,Illinois State Medical Society,Chicago Medical Society,American Orthopaedic Foot And Ankle Society,Illinois Association of Orthopaedic Surgeons,American Association of Orthopaedic Foot and Ankle Surgeons,Pedorthic Footwear Association,Northwestern Medical Private Practice Association,Mid-America Orthopaedic Association and Clinical Associate Professor, Feinberg School of Medicine. Some of the services provided by the doctor are: Peripheral Autonomic Neuropathy,Tenosynovitis,Foot & Ankle,deformities of the foot and ankle and Seropositive Rheumatoid Arthritis etc.
